  4. It's not for the players. It's for all the cities like Cincy where the fans only care on Opening Day and if it rains out they can play the next day and all those fans can still use their tickets for "Opening Day." I hate it too, but I would do the same thing if I was in their place. I liked the Sports Guy's idea of having opening day for everybody be Sunday afternoon. You can have an opening night game on ESPN still. There's nothing going on between Final 4 Saturday and Championship Monday. More people could avoid conflicts with work to attend games. More people could catch the games on TV. You could also schedule the occasional 4 game series that first week, which would help deal with some of the odd quirks with the varied divisions. I read that today too, and I completely agree. I don't know of any reason why MLB couldn't start everything on Sunday instead of Monday. It would incread the convience for millions of fans. Then again, we are talking about MLB and this plan makes too much sense for them to implement it.
